I'm doing SW from home and have been following Green days since I started, I want to try out Extra Easy for a few days to see if it works better for me but it confuses me a little... could somebody explain it please? I'm so stupid and confused :D x
 
LinzLinz said:
I'm doing SW from home and have been following Green days since I started, I want to try out Extra Easy for a few days to see if it works better for me but it confuses me a little... could somebody explain it please? I'm so stupid and confused :D x

It's the one I find easiest as its not really any weighing apart from healthy extras. You can eat all free food from green and red and 1/3 of your plate should be Superfree food. Choose one hexA and one hexB and you'll be fine :)

how many successful at home Sw's are there?

Just wondered how mant people actually manage SW at home. I find that not having the abilty to work out syns a problem. I know the 20 cal rule but what about other elements of foods. The peolple doing WW at home have that edge, there are calculators on line they can use.
 
I started off going to the meetings but only got weighed and it seemed such a waste of money so left after losing my first half a stone. Continued at home and lost a further 2 stone and am now maintaining successfully.
 
I have been doing myself at home now for 5 weeks and doing well, only really minimins and find all the support/advice i need here and even when on the go, i have the app on my phone :)
 
I do, I do!!
I've lost 4 and a half stone since July. If you've got the basic books (food directory is helpful too but not essential) you'll soon get to know what's what.
I've lent the books to my mum so haven't used them since before christmas but know the free foods and healthy extras and look up syns on here if unsure (although generally use the 20 cals = 1 syn rule).
Best of luck, if you are determined, you will succeed. x
